Watch: Dark Mystery Short Film 'f r e d' Made by Alexander Jeremy
Phoebe Cates and Rik Mayall in Drop Dead Fred (1991)
"When death comes, as it does for us all... Life is changed, not ended... They are never truly gone, for the spirit remains." A very unique short film to watch - now available online. Fred, stylized as f r e d, is a short film written and directed by British filmmaker Alexander Jeremy. It premiered at a few festivals last year and won an award for a spontaneous musical dance sequence. A woman struggles to come to terms with the loss of her fiancé, but below the surface, a darker story lurks. "Almost two years ago one of my best mates passed away. I decided to make a short film and dedicate it to him." Starring Samuel Woodhams as Fred, plus Susie Kimnell, Shaun Prendergast, & Nathan Gordon. "We are proud that we made something that is original, bold and unique," Jeremy states. And it certainly is. "Give yourself a half-hour and sink in.

Berlin: McDonagh’s ‘War On Everyone’ among first Panorama titles
Rebecca Miller at an event for The Private Lives of Pippa Lee (2009)
Other titles include Rebecca Miller’s Maggie’s Plan, starring Greta Gerwig, and David Farr’s The Ones Below, starring David Morrissey.Scroll down for full lists

The Berlin International Film Festival (Feb 11-21) has announced the first titles in Panorama – its strand that comprises new independent and arthouse films that deal with controversial subjects or unconventional aesthetic styles.

The initial features include three from the UK, with John Michael McDonagh returning to Berlin for the world premiere of War On Everyone.

The film, a satire centred on two corrupt cops in New Mexico, stars Alexander Skarsgård, Michael Peña, Theo James and Tessa Thompson.

McDonagh was previously in Panorama in 2011 with The Guard and 2013 with Calvary.

Also from the UK is David Farr’s The Ones Below, which revolves around a couple expecting their first child who discover an unnerving difference between themselves and the couple living in the flat below. Receiving its European...

The HeyUGuys Interview: Stephen Tompkinson Gives Us the Lowdown on Harrigan
Before British cop drama Harrigan hits our cinema screens on September 20, we had the great pleasure of speaking to the lead role, Detective Harrigan himself, Stephen Tompkinson.

Harrigan – which is director Vince Woods debut feature film, is set in a bleak, 1970s North East, where a close-to-retirement cop Barry Harrigan returns to his hometown with a score to settle. Tompkinson, who has made a name for himself in films such as Brassed Off and TV shows such as In Deep, speaks of his own experience in Britain from the time this film is set, and what attracted him to the role – while he reflects on what has been a triumphant, and certainly expansive career.
